Output 1c40d3cba69ffd8dbc9078585b7de96308fd6491e6d0b3594c6edc05e72d745d:21

value
27041000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c77a109ef505865f35a5fa771da54af7c1800c OP_EQUAL
address
3CX4d589d7j19HsNrE9R3J4z1KSjh1XyXh
transaction
1c40d3cba69ffd8dbc9078585b7de96308fd6491e6d0b3594c6edc05e72d745d
spent
true